Galecto Inc (GLTO) is not a strong buy at the moment for a beginner investor with a long-term strategy. While the stock has a bullish technical setup and strong analyst support with high price targets, the lack of recent positive news, insider selling, poor financial performance, and no significant trading signals suggest that waiting for further developments or a better entry point would be more prudent.
The technical indicators show a bullish trend with MACD positively expanding, RSI in the neutral zone, and moving averages aligned bullishly (SMA_5 > SMA_20 > SMA_200). Key resistance levels are at R1: 31.166 and R2: 34.166, while support levels are at S1: 21.456 and S2: 18.456.

Analysts have given strong Buy ratings with high price targets ranging from $40 to $46, citing the potential of Galecto's lead asset DMR-001 in addressing critical oncology needs. The company's recent financing was well-received, showing high demand and minimal dilution.
Insiders have significantly increased their selling activity (503.37% increase in the last month), which raises concerns about internal confidence. Financial performance is weak, with net income and EPS showing significant declines in the latest quarter. No recent news or Congress trading data to act as a catalyst.
In Q3 2025, the company reported no revenue growth (0% YoY), a net income decline of -19.31% YoY, and a significant drop in EPS (-30.38% YoY). Gross margin remains at 0%, indicating no profitability.
Analysts are highly optimistic, with multiple Buy ratings and price targets ranging from $40 to $46. They highlight the potential of DMR-001 as a best-in-class therapy for oncology, with peak sales projections of $6.3B.
